SAINT MARY-OF-THE-WOODS — Greencastle freshman Evan Crowe recorded the first assist in St. Mary-of-the-Woods College men’s soccer history on Wednesday in a scrimmage against Franklin College.

Crowe assisted teammate Nicolas Castrillon for the first goal of the match as the Pomeroys make their debut in the sport this fall.

The Pomeroys and Grizzlies eventually tied 2-2.

Crowe and the Pomeroys open their season officially on Sunday as they host Brescia at 3 p.m.

Crowe was a standout at Greencastle, leading the Cubs to sectional and conference crowns last season.
